City beat Baggies to close on Liverpool




MANCHESTER: Manchester City narrowed the gap to Premier League leaders Liverpool to six points with a comfortable 3-1 victory over West Bromwich Albion at Eastlands on Monday.

Pablo Zabaleta, Sergio Aguero and Martin Demichelis all scored for City as three different Argentinian players netted in a Premier League match for the first time.

West Brom showed brief moments of skills and had pulled the score back to 2-1 through Graham Dorrans, but ultimately City had too much quality.

City will close further on Liverpool should they win their game in hand, although they still need the Merseyside club to drop points in their remaining three games if they are to take the title themselves. (AFP)
